The contemporary monumental building in the Roman style with a basilica ceiling was completed at the beginning of the twentieth century. Despite reconstructions, the parish church continued to decay. In addition, it was insufficient for the large parish. It was necessary to consider building a new one.
The Premonstratensian Monastery in Želiv is a national heritage site, a popular place of pilgrimage, and a traditional destination for both Czech and foreign tourists seeking a calm place for spiritual regeneration and physical relaxation. Just as in the past, even today the Monastery is a centre of spiritual life.
